Description
MCP Gateway allows easy and secure running and deployment of MCP servers. From 0.21.0 until 0.42.2, Docker MCP Gateway YAML-unmarshalled the attacker-controlled io.docker.server.metadata OCI image label into the broad catalog.Server structure for direct docker:// references and catalog snapshot imports in pkg/oci/self_contained.go and pkg/workingset/workingset.go. Runtime-shaping fields including Volumes, User, and ExtraHosts were then appended to the docker run argument vector without an origin allowlist, allowing a malicious image author to request host filesystem or Docker socket mounts and UID 0 execution when a victim selected or pulled the image. This container-creation-time boundary bypass can execute arbitrary code on the host and is not prevented by no-new-privileges because no in-container privilege escalation is required. This issue is fixed in version 0.42.2.
Affected Packages
| Ecosystem | Package | Vulnerable range | Fix |
|---|---|---|---|
| 🐹Go | github.com/docker/mcp-gateway | ≥ 0.21.0&&< 0.42.2 | 0.42.2 |
